Air New Zealand now expects a loss before taxation for the first half of the 2026 financial year in the range of $30 million to $55m.In August, it said it expected earnings before taxation for the first half of the 2026 financial year to be similar or less than the $34m reported in the second half of the 2025 financial year.According to Air NZ, it had anticipated a 2% to 3% revenue uplift across domestic and US-bound bookings.“This has not materialised to date and is not yet evident in the current forward booking profile, the impact of wh...
